Frase logo

Frase

Frase

Paid

Platform for researching, writing, and SEO-optimizing GEO and search-focused content with AI-driven recommendations.

Key features

  • Topic Research: Analyzes search results and related queries to identify high-value topics, common questions, and subtopics to include in briefs and articles.
  • AI Writing Assistant: Generates draft content, section copy, and suggested paragraphs based on briefs and target keywords to accelerate writing.
  • Content Brief Generator: Automatically builds SEO-focused briefs with recommended headings, questions, and target keywords to guide writers and improve topical coverage.
  • SERP & Competitor Analysis: Compares top-ranking pages to surface common headings, word counts, and entity coverage so users can optimize content to match search intent.
  • GEO Content Optimization: Supports geographically targeted content creation and optimization to improve local search relevance and rankings.
  • Answer Engine Optimization: Identifies question-and-answer opportunities and structures content to capture featured snippets and other answer-focused SERP features.
  • Content Scoring & Recommendations: Provides data-driven content scores and actionable suggestions (keywords, topics, length) to improve performance against competitors.
  • Integrations & Workflow Tools: Offers integrations and workspace features to manage briefs, drafts, and team collaboration across content projects.

Port Radar for macOS logo

Port Radar for macOS

Juan Sebastian Solano

Free

Free open-source Mac menu bar app that lists every listening localhost port and uses on-device Apple Intelligence to explain what each process is.

Key features

  • Menu Bar Port Scanner: Lists every listening localhost port in the menu bar with port number, PID, owning project, runtime, and the exact command line.
  • Apple Intelligence Explanations: Ask in plain language what a process is, why it has been running, and whether stopping it is safe; answers are generated on-device with no cloud call.
  • Project Grouping: Groups processes by the project directory that owns them and flags shared or orphaned processes with no obvious parent.
  • One-Click Cloudflare Tunnels: Share any local port as a public URL through a Cloudflare quick tunnel, auto-installing cloudflared with no CLI, ngrok, or account setup.
  • Clean Process Control: Stop a process gracefully or force-quit it with a confirmation step, directly from the menu bar.
  • Live Tunnel Management: See which tunnels are currently live and public, copy their URLs, and stop them at any time.
  • Fully On-Device Privacy: All inspection and AI explanation happens locally; no process data or command lines are sent off the machine.
  • Open Source Under Apache 2.0: The full source is published on GitHub, so the app can be audited or built from source.

Best for

  • Port Conflict Debugging: Finding out which forgotten process is holding port 3000 before starting a new dev server.
  • Runaway Process Triage: Identifying a Node or Python process quietly eating CPU and deciding whether it is safe to kill.
  • Preview Sharing: Handing a teammate or client a live public URL for a work-in-progress local app in seconds.
  • Multi-Project Development: Keeping track of which of several simultaneously running projects owns each active port.
  • Onboarding and Handover: Letting a developer new to a codebase understand what the local stack actually starts up.
  • Privacy-Sensitive Environments: Getting AI assistance about local processes in settings where sending command lines to a cloud model is unacceptable.
